Egg Allergen Safety Guide for Miami Food Businesses

Egg allergies affect millions of Americans and represent one of the top food allergens requiring strict disclosure. Miami-Dade County and Florida enforce specific allergen labeling regulations through the FDA Food Allergen Labeling and Consumer Protection Act (FALCPA) and state-level requirements. Understanding these rules and tracking allergen recalls is essential for protecting customers and avoiding compliance violations.

Florida Allergen Disclosure & Labeling Laws

Florida follows federal FALCPA standards, which require clear allergen declarations on packaged egg products and prepared foods. The FDA mandates that "egg" be plainly labeled on all products containing this major allergen, either in the ingredient list or in a separate "Contains" statement. Miami-Dade County Health Department enforces these rules through routine inspections and violations carry fines up to $500 per violation. Food service establishments, bakeries, and manufacturers must maintain ingredient documentation and train staff on allergen cross-contact prevention to comply with state food safety codes.

Recent Undeclared Egg Allergen Recalls in Florida

The FDA and FSIS regularly issue recalls for products with undeclared egg ingredients, including baked goods, sauces, marinades, and processed meats containing egg-based binders. Between 2023-2026, multiple recalls affected Florida retailers due to missing allergen labels on products manufactured in multi-facility operations. Allergen Safety Resources & Compliance Support in Miami

The Miami-Dade County Health Department offers food safety training and allergen certification programs for restaurant staff and food handlers. The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ation (DBPR) enforces allergen handling rules and provides compliance guidance through its Division of Hotels and Restaurants.
